Banana Splits
Yes, we have a jar of petro-chemical based "cherries" lurking in our pantry. No, I am not ashamed. Unsurprisingly, my "testers" consumed these with glee. Next time I might need to put a bit of whipped cream around the base of the ice cream.
1 banana, peeled and sliced
1/2 cup chocolate frozen yogurt
1/4 cup crispy brown rice cereal
